Output e3f638829897a5a90585ecb3aabea8c279fc539b94241b0c2f8a9a5bd383f631:15

value
853664
script pubkey
OP_0 OP_PUSHBYTES_20 5d88d91a38b58a46c239ffcc7bbd5b98440717d3
address
bc1qtkydjx3ckk9yds3ellx8h02mnpzqw97n2rz4fz
transaction
e3f638829897a5a90585ecb3aabea8c279fc539b94241b0c2f8a9a5bd383f631
spent
true